(KNZA)--A garage was destroyed by fire at a Hiawatha residence early Tuesday morning.
Hiawatha Fire Chief Gene Atland said firefighters were called to 112 Kickapoo Street around 4:00.
Atland said when firefighters arrived, the detached garage was pretty well gone.
He said firefighters remained on the scene about an hour.
The fire was confined to the garage.
No injuries were reported.
Atland said the state Fire Marshal's Office has been contacted to investigate the cause of fire, but the fire doesn't appear to be suspicious.
